What is Pg.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a collection of small programs that can be used by many different software programs on a computer. These files allow various programs to perform specific tasks without needing to have all the code within the main executable file of the software. The Pg.dll file is specifically related to the software ActivePerl 5.14.2 Build 1402 64-bit.

It helps ActivePerl to interact with PostgreSQL databases by providing necessary functions and procedures to access and manipulate data within the PostgreSQL database system. In the context of ActivePerl 5.14.2 Build 1402 64-bit, Pg.dll is crucial as it enables the effective integration of ActivePerl with the PostgreSQL database system. Without Pg.dll, ActivePerl would not be able to communicate with the PostgreSQL database, hindering its ability to effectively manage and manipulate data within this specific database system.

Therefore, Pg.dll plays a vital role in ensuring the smooth and efficient functioning of ActivePerl with PostgreSQL.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• Pg.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to Pg.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.
  • Cannot register Pg.dll: This error is indicative of the system's inability to correctly register the DLL file. This might occur due to issues with the Windows Registry or because the DLL file itself is corrupt or improperly installed.
  • Pg.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.
  • Pg.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message indicates that the DLL file is either not compatible with your Windows version or has an internal problem. It could be due to a programming error in the DLL, or an attempt to use a DLL from a different version of Windows.
  • The file Pg.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
